Róhe Is The Under-The-Radar Brand Vogue Editors Are Raving About

When British Vogue’s commerce director, Naomi Smart, first discovered the brand at a Matches event back in 2023, she was drawn to its impeccable black coat offering, but quickly learned it had much more to offer. “Out of the entire Matches website, Rohé was the clear winner when it came to quality of cut and price point, and ever since the event, I’ve been hooked–it’s become my go-to for solid wardrobe classics that I wear non-stop,” she explains. “Earlier this summer, I also visited the brand’s atelier in Amsterdam, and I picked up a number of pieces that, whenever I wear them to the office, I get stopped and interrogated about every five seconds. If you love The Row, Toteme or Raey (RIP), then you need to get Rohé on your radar immediately. Oh, and they do menswear, too. You’re welcome.”

It didn’t take long for word to spread across the pond, where Vogue.com’s senior fashion market editor, Maddy Fass, has also fallen for the brand’s easy elegance. Just this month, at Copenhagen Fashion Week, Fass was papped in the brand’s grey knotted jumper–which she styled with horseshoe jeans and red strappy sandals–and the cream lace-trimmed slip dress. “I love discovering brands that make pieces that are ultra wearable yet still feel special, and Róhe’s minimally-minded assortment does just that,” she says. “It excels at creating those little details that take an essential from ‘good’ to ‘great’.”
